Young Hegelians (or Left Hegelians)

Ideologists of the German liberalism in the 1830s-1840s, representatives of the radical wing of Hegel's philosophical school. In the conditions prevailing in Germany at that time their interpretation of Hegelian philosophy and their criticism of Christianity were but a specific form of bourgeois-democratic thought and political interest in general.

David F. Strauss' book, Das Leben Jesu (1835), which critically analysed the Gospel dogmas, promoted the formation of the Hegelian Left wing. Strauss considered Jesus as an ordinary historical personality, whose supernatural entity was due to a myth. The next step in the criticism of religion as a false form of consciousness was made by Bruno Bauer. He regarded the Gospel dogmas as deliberate inventions and the person of Jesus as fiction.

The theories of the Young Hegelians were but the first attempt, modelled on religion, to analyse social consciousness as a social structure (ideology). Their attention was centred on the question of how false concepts of society appear and acquire the force of compulsion. Strauss explained this by the traditional persistency of mythological views. Bauer saw the source of this phenomenon in the "alienation" of the products of individual "self-consciousness", in that the products of the human mind were considered as abstractions independent of it.

The critical analysis of the idealist doctrine of the Young Hegelians laid bare the limitedness of a purely immanent analysis of social consciousness and pointed to the necessity for investigating material social relations, for deducing from them the spiritual life of society. To a certain extent this necessity was grasped by Feuerbach. The task was fulfilled by Marx and Engels, who joined the Young Hegelians movement at the beginning of the 1840s. But they arrived at a radically new understanding of social development-the theory of historical materialism.

The bankruptcy of the Young Hegelians movement as bourgeois radicalism is seen most clearly in its underestimation of the role of the masses in history. This is clear from the works of Stirner, one of the forerunners of anarchism. The ideas of class struggle, of the objective laws of social development, and of the role of economic relations in the life of society were alien to the Young Hegelians. Their characteristic feature was revolutionary phraseology, containing only liberal threats to the ruling classes who were trying to arrest the bourgeois development of Germany. They regarded the masses as the "enemy of the spirit" and progress. According to them, the "critically thinking individual" was the motive force of history. Marx and Engels sharply criticised the ideas of the Young Hegelians in their works, The Holy Family and The German Ideology.

Гегельянство

Обозначение идеалистических философских течений, исходивших из учения Г. Гегеля и развивавших его идеи. Возникло в Германии в 30-40-х гг. 19 в. В спорах по религиозным вопросам внутри гегелевской школы выделилось несколько направлений. Т. н. правогегельянство трактовало Гегеля в духе религиозной ортодоксии (К. Гёшель, Г. Хинрихс, Г. Габлер), рассматривая его философскую систему как рациональную форму богословия. Оппозиционное левое Г., или младогегельянство (А. Руге, Б. Бауэр, Л. Фейербах и др.), подчёркивало решающую роль личностного, субъективного фактора в истории (противопоставляя его гегелевскому всемирному духу). Промежуточное положение занимало «ортодоксальное» Г., стремившееся сохранить учение Г. в его «чистоте» (К. Михелет, К. Розенкранц и др.). Критика младогегельянства была дана в работах К. Маркса и Ф. Энгельса «Святое семейство» (1844) и «Немецкая идеология»

(1845-46). По пути преодоления младогегельянства пошли Г. Гейне в Германии, А. И. Герцен и В. Г. Белинский в России. Дальнейшее развитие Г. вышло за пределы собственно гегелевской школы. Возрождение интереса к Гегелю в буржуазной философии 2-й половины 19 - начала 20 вв. вызвало появление в различных странах многообразных течений т. н. неогегельянства.
